Abstract

The utility model discloses an environment-friendly and healthy mask printing device, which comprises a substrate and a material frame, wherein the top end of the substrate is sequentially provided with the material frame, a plurality of pressing devices and a plurality of collecting frames from left to right, the pressing devices are distributed along the length direction of the substrate at equal intervals, the bottom of the substrate is provided with a printing device, the printing device is provided with a plurality of printing devices, the printing devices and the plurality of pressing devices are arranged in a one-to-one correspondence manner, an ink pump in an ink box is pumped into a spray pipe after being started during printing, the ink is sprayed out to the surface of a printing roller from one side of the spray pipe, the printing roller is fed through the ink pump without being influenced by ink allowance, an even coating mechanism integrally plays a role in scraping off redundant ink on the surface of the printing roller and coating the ink evenly, and the color of printed patterns is consistent in shade, the thickness of the ink on the surface of the printing roller which is leveled by the uniform smearing mechanism is moderate, and the ink is not easy to splash during printing.

Detailed Description
The technical solution in the embodiments of the present invention will be clearly and completely described below with reference to the accompanying drawings in the embodiments of the present invention.
Referring to fig. 1-4, the present invention provides the following technical solutions: the utility model provides a healthy gauze mask printing device of environmental protection, including base plate 1 and material frame 2, the top of base plate 1 has from left to right set gradually material frame 2, closing device 5 and receipts material frame 7, closing device 5 has a plurality of, and a plurality of closing device 5 distributes along base plate 1's length direction equidistance, base plate 1's bottom is provided with printing device 4, printing device 4 has a plurality of, a plurality of printing device 4 sets up with a plurality of closing device 5 one-to-one, logical groove has been seted up on base plate 1's surface, it has a plurality of to lead to the groove, and a plurality of leads to the groove and staggers the arrangement with a plurality of closing device 5, the inside that leads to the groove is provided with drying device 6.
Preferably, the printing and dyeing device 4 includes an ink tank 41 and an even smearing mechanism 42, the even smearing mechanism 42 is disposed in the middle of the ink tank 41, a printing roller 43 is rotatably connected to the top of the even smearing mechanism 42, the top of the printing roller 43 penetrates through the ink tank 41 and the substrate 1, a speed reduction motor 46 is fixedly connected to the outer wall of the ink tank 41, an output shaft of the speed reduction motor 46 is fixedly connected to one end of the printing roller 43, a spraying pipe 45 is fixedly connected to one side of the inside of the ink tank 41, an ink pump 44 is fixedly connected to one side of the outer wall of the ink tank 41, an input end of the ink pump 44 is fixedly communicated with a first conduit, one end of the first conduit penetrates through the side wall of the ink tank 41 to the bottom of the ink tank 41, an output end of the ink pump 44 is fixedly communicated with the middle of the spraying pipe 45 through a second conduit, when in use, the ink pump 44 pumps the ink into the spraying pipe 45 and sprays out from one side of the spraying pipe 45 to the surface of the printing roller 43, the uniform smearing mechanism 42 scrapes off redundant ink on the surface of the printing roller 43, and smears the ink uniformly, so as to ensure that the color depth of the printed pattern is consistent.
Preferably, the uniform smearing mechanism 42 comprises a housing 421 and a smearing roller 422, the smearing roller 422 is rotatably connected inside the housing 421, the top of the smearing roller 422 is tangent to the bottom of the printing roller 43, the top and the bottom of the housing 421 are both provided with openings, the two sides of the outer wall of the housing 421 are respectively and fixedly connected with a scraping plate 423 and a smearing plate 424, one side of the bottom opening of the housing 421 is fixedly connected with a V-shaped plate 425, one end of the V-shaped plate 425 is tangent to the bottom of the smearing roller 422, the printing roller 43 rotates, when passing through the top end of the scraping plate 423, scraping plate 423 scrapes off the redundant ink on the surface of printing roller 43, the bottom of printing roller 43 is tangent with the top of inking roller 422, inking roller 422 further dips in the redundant ink on the surface of printing roller 43, floating plate 424 scrapes off the printing roller 43 after dipping in, makes the ink on the surface of printing roller 43 more even, avoids ink to form the bump point shape, improves printing quality.
Preferably, closing device 5 includes mounting bracket 51 and slider 52, the spout has all been seted up to mounting bracket 51's both sides, the inside sliding connection of spout has slider 52, one side fixedly connected with limiting plate 53 of slider 52, slider 52's top fixedly connected with pressure spring 54, the top of pressure spring 54 and the top fixed connection of spout, be provided with pressure roller 55 between two sliders 52, pressure roller 55's both ends rotate with two sliders 52 respectively and are connected, under pressure spring 54's elasticity, pressure roller 55 compresses tightly the gauze mask at the top of printing roller 43, make the pattern of printing more clear, improve the printing quality.
Preferably, drying device 6 includes bed frame 61 and heating pipe 62, and the top fixed connection of heating pipe 62 is in the inside of logical groove, and the bottom fixed connection of bed frame 61 has heating pipe 62, carries out in time drying through heating pipe 62 after the printing, avoids mixing with the printing ink of next printing, makes the pattern obscure.
Preferably, the equal fixedly connected with support frame 3 in both sides on 1 top of base plate, two support frames 3 are located one side of material frame 2 and receive one side of material frame 7 respectively, and the middle part of support frame 3 is rotated and is connected with guide roll 31, and support frame 3 plays the effect of guide gauze mask, the printing of being convenient for.
Preferably, one end of the substrate 1 is fixedly connected with a power switch 8, the ink pumps 44, the speed reducing motor 46 and the heating pipes 62 are all electrically connected with an external power supply through the power switch 8, the power switch 8 is closed, the plurality of ink pumps 44 are powered on, and the plurality of speed reducing motors 46 and the plurality of heating pipes 62 are all powered on to work.
